Even public tv has become subject to the influence of advertising. Developed in 1969, (PBS) established out of a report by the Carnegie Compensation on Educational Television, which examined the function of academic, noncommercial television on culture. The report suggested that the federal government money public television in order to give diversity of shows throughout the network eraa service created "not to market products" yet to "improve citizenship and civil service (McCauley, 2003)." Public tv was also meant to supply global access to tv for audiences in rural areas or customers that could not manage to pay for exclusive television solutions.

Other than a tiny part of airtime managed by public tv, the three major networks (referred to as the Big 3) dominated the television sector, collectively accounting for even more than 95 percent of prime-time viewing. In 1986, Rupert Murdoch, the head of international company News Corp, launched the Fox network, testing the prominence of the Big 3.

Having produced the very first "superstation," Turner broadened his world by founding 24-hour news network CNN in 1980. At the end of the year, 28 nationwide shows services were available, and the cable television revolution had started. Over the following decade, the sector went through a period of quick development and appeal, and by 1994 visitors might select from 94 standard and 20 costs cable services.
